Think of a backlink as a vote of confidence. When a trusted website links to yours, it signals to Google that your content is valuable, trustworthy, and authoritative. Search engines, especially Google, view these votes as a major factor in ranking your site. The more high-quality backlinks you have from relevant and reputable sites, the higher your website authority Singapore will be. This boosts your chances of ranking for important keywords.

Strategic Guest Posting: Your Voice on Singapore-Based Blogs

One of the most effective white-hat link building strategies in Singapore is guest posting. This means writing a high-quality article for another site or blog in your industry. In return, you receive a backlink to your site, usually in your author bio or naturally placed within the content.

The goal here is not to spam every blog you find. It’s about identifying the right blogs that align with your brand and audience. Your market knowledge of Singapore becomes your advantage. Look for guest blogging opportunities for Singapore businesses that are relevant and have a genuine following.

Here’s a step-by-step guide to mastering guest posting:

  • Identify Target Blogs: Create a list of blogs, magazines, and news sites in Singapore that cover topics related to your industry. For instance, if you are in fitness, seek health and wellness blogs in Singapore. Use search queries such as:
    • “your niche” + “guest post” + “Singapore”
    • “write for us” + “Singapore business”
    • “guest blogging opportunities” + “your industry”
    • “contribute to our site” + “Singapore”
  • Analyze Their Authority: Once you have your list, use an SEO tool to check their Domain Authority (DA) or Domain Rating (DR). A high score, over 40 is a good target, indicates a powerful site. Also, check their traffic and engagement. Does the blog receive comments? Is it active on social media? A blog with high traffic and engagement is far more valuable than a high-DA site with no audience.
  • Craft a Compelling Pitch: Don’t send a generic request. Read their content, understand their audience, and propose a unique, valuable article idea. Your pitch should show that you’ve done your research. For example, instead of saying, “I want to write about SEO,” you could say, “I would love to write a piece on ‘The Top 5 Backlink Strategies for Small Businesses in Singapore’ to help your readers navigate the competitive market.”
  • Create 10x Content: Once your pitch is accepted, your task is to deliver an article that is ten times better than what’s out there on the topic. It should be comprehensive, actionable, and enjoyable to read. This is your chance to showcase your expertise and earn a strong contextual backlink.

Building Partnerships: Your Gateway to Local Backlinks

For local SEO Singapore, building partnerships with other Singapore-based businesses is a valuable strategy. This involves creating mutually beneficial relationships that result in natural, highly relevant backlinks.

How can building partnerships for local backlinks in Singapore benefit you?

Cross-Promotion: Partner with non-competing businesses that serve a similar audience. For example, a bakery could collaborate with a local cafe for a joint promotion. Feature each other on your blogs, social media, and newsletters to create reciprocal links. This is an effective way to gain backlinks in Singapore while expanding your reach.

Supplier/Vendor Endorsements:If you use a local service or product that you appreciate, offer to write a testimonial. Often, the business will gladly feature your testimonial on their site, typically with a link back to yours. This is a simple, genuine way to earn links.

Sponsorships and Events: Sponsoring a local community event or charity can lead to a backlink from the event’s website or related media coverage. This approach helps you give back to the community while enhancing your online presence.

Interview Features: Seek out local industry podcasts, YouTube channels, or blogs that interview local business owners. Being featured as an expert can lead to an editorial backlink from a trusted local source. This is a key part of how Singapore companies can improve website authority.

The Power of Local SEO and Citations

Beyond just backlinks, your local SEO Singapore efforts are essential for any physical or service-based business. A significant part of this involves building citations and claiming your local business listings.

Citations refer to mentions of your business name, address, and phone number (NAP) on other websites. While they don’t always include a hyperlink, they still send a strong signal to Google about your business’s legitimacy and location.

Google My Business (GMB): This is the most crucial local listing. Ensure your profile is complete and accurate; it forms the foundation of your local presence.

Online Directories: List your business on major Singapore directories like Yellow Pages Singapore, Yelp Singapore, and industry-specific listings. These directories are trusted by search engines and provide valuable foundational links and citations.

Media Mentions: Use tools like Google Alerts to monitor mentions of your business name. If you appear in a local news article or blog post without a link, contact the author to politely request they add a link back to your site. This is a proactive backlink strategy for small businesses in Singapore.
